Peygamberler Diyarı is a fascinating documentary from 1966, directed by Åevket AktunƧ. It dives into the rich tapestry of religious history and cultural narratives, focusing on prophets as a central theme. The pacing is contemplative, allowing viewers to absorb the weight of the stories being told. The film captures various locations, offering a sense of place that feels both reverent and intriguing. There's a rawness to the footage that gives it a unique character, almost like a time capsule of thought and belief from that era. While the performances aren't traditional in the acting sense, the sincerity of the subjects shines through. It's a distinctive piece that reflects on faith and folklore in a way that invites reflection rather than just observation.
